Transforming Healthcare Through Technology

The landscape of healthcare in 2026 has undergone a remarkable transformation driven by technological innovations such as artificial intelligence, smart devices, digital diagnostics, and individualized wellness tools. This new paradigm has pulled healthcare from clinical settings into the daily lives of individuals, making health tech one of the most influential trends shaping global healthcare systems and reshaping consumer habits.

Wearable devices monitor our vital signs in real-time, AI enhanced diagnostics identify health conditions more swiftly than conventional methods, and personalized care solutions provide advice tailored to an individual's genetic, behavioral, and lifestyle information. Such innovations empower individuals to better understand their health and take proactive steps for injury prevention and enhanced longevity.

In this new era, health tech acts not only as a provider of better care but also as a democratizing force in healthcare access.

The Role of Wearable Technology in Personal Health Management

Evolving Wearables: From Gadgets to Health Allies

Wearable devices have evolved significantly from basic fitness trackers to advanced health monitoring companions, capable of capturing a wide array of biometric data.

Contemporary wearables can track:

  • heart rate and variability

  • breathing patterns

  • sleep cycles and quality measures

  • oxygen saturation levels

  • changes in body temperature

  • stress levels

  • caloric output and physical activity

Reasons Behind the Popularity Surge of Wearables
  • growing emphasis on preventive healthcare

  • increasing rates of chronic illnesses

  • demand for immediate insights

  • smartphone and health app integrations

As a result, wearables have become essential tools for individuals taking charge of their health journey.

Advanced Sensors Provide New Insights

The latest advancements in sensors have empowered wearables to capture subtle physiological changes that were previously only recorded in clinical environments.

New Sensor Capabilities in 2026
  • non-invasive glucose monitoring

  • tracking hydration and electrolytes

  • early warnings for respiratory illnesses

  • insights on menstrual cycles and fertility

  • predictive analyses for burnout and fatigue

These capabilities provide users the opportunity to make informed decisions preemptively, averting potential health concerns.

Diverse Wearable Formats Leading the Charge

Wearables have diversified to cater to various lifestyles.

Prominent Wearable Categories
  • Smartwatches: all-in-one health dashboards

  • Smart Rings: subtle health monitoring

  • Health Patches: continuous medical monitoring

  • Brainwave Headbands: tracking mental wellness

This variety ensures health tracking integrates seamlessly into daily life.

AI-Driven Diagnostics: Pioneering Early Detection

A Revolution in Diagnostic Precision

AI systems are transforming diagnostics, analyzing health data with astonishing accuracy surpassing traditional techniques.

AI can assess:

  • medical imaging

  • biomarkers in blood

  • genetic information

  • wearable-generated data

  • previous health records

Benefits of AI in Diagnostics
  • swift recognition of disease indicators

  • minimized diagnostic inaccuracies

  • faster intervention strategies

  • enhanced patient outcomes

The powerful capability of AI to process vast data sets makes it ideal for early detection frameworks.

Home Diagnostics Become Standard Practice

Technological innovation has made medical testing possible at home. Remote diagnostic kits allow for assessment of various conditions without a clinic visit.

Trending At-Home Diagnostic Tests in 2026
  • microbiome assessments

  • hormonal screenings

  • glucose testing

  • sleep disorder evaluations

  • genetic risk assessments

Results are evaluated by AI and presented in user-friendly formats.

Predictive Healthcare Models

AI holds the ability to forecast health risks long before symptoms manifest through long-term data analysis.

Prospective Predictive Functions
  • risk evaluation for heart-related incidents

  • predicting metabolism disorders

  • recognizing mental health challenges

  • anticipating sleep problems

  • evaluating stress levels

Predictive healthcare marks a pivotal shift from reactive to proactive medical approaches.

Inequities in the Health Tech Landscape

Concerns Regarding Data Privacy and Security

With increased digital adoption comes the risk of exposing personal health information. Ensuring both secure storage and responsible use is paramount.

Critical Issues
  • potential misuse of health data

  • risk of unauthorized access

  • necessity for transparency in data handling

Trust is essential for the long-term acceptance of health technology.

Excessive Dependence on Technology

While technology enhances healthcare, it cannot dedup clinical expertise. Over-reliance may lead to miscalibrated interpretations or needless anxiety.

The Accessibility Divide

Communities do not uniformly benefit from advanced health monitoring tools. Addressing these disparities is crucial for equitable healthcare access.
